Summary: |
| Dense but interesting history of the formation of labor unions in the United States. Describes the origin and history of strikes and discusses their purpose and effectiveness. Fairly balanced look at the relationship between labor unions and employers. Text is dated and is missing the last 20 years of labor history. |
Teaching Ideas: |
| Chapters could be used with teacher guidance to give more information about certain periods in history and how labor/unions affected that era. The book ends with questions about the future. Since it was written in 1985, much of the future is already known and could be research and the book info updated |
